
The Facts: According to NFL Network's Mike Garafolo, Garcon's deal with the Niners is expected to be a three-year contract that pays about $23 million over the first two years with a signing bonus worth about $12 million.

Garcon, 30, spent five years with the Redskins, fulfilling a deal he signed in the 2012 offseason, and had 376 receptions, 21 touchdowns and averaged 12.1 yards per catch. His best season with the team came in 2013, when Garcon caught 113 passes for 1,346 yards and five touchdowns while playing in then-offensive coordinator Kyle Shanahan's offense.
